Bookkeeping is the process of recording daily transactions in a consistent way, and is a key component to building a financially successful business. Bookkeepers take care of the day-to-day financials, like posting credits and debits, maintaining the general ledger, and completing payroll.
Accounting is a high-level process that uses financial information compiled by a bookkeeper or business owner, and produces financial models using that information. Some accountants do bookkeeping also, especially at year-end when their client’s haven’t gotten around to do it or when incorrectly categorised transactions need to be fixed. Quite often, accounting fees are significantly higher, so it may be more cost-effective to get a bookkeeper to review your bookkeeping before it gets sent to the accountant for filing.
